Abstract
The use of pozzolan in cement provides economic advantages and improves the physico-mechanical properties of cement. Fly ash and blast furnace slag are widely used in cement as pozzolanic materials. In this study, obsidian known as volcanic glass which crops out in the Ikizdere (Rize) region of NE Turkey was investigated as a pozzolana in cement.
